Fig. 5: TGF-β inhibition improved hematopoietic recovery by repairing BM EC damage in AA mice.
From: TGF-β inhibition restores hematopoiesis and immune balance via bone marrow EPCs in aplastic anemia

a–d, Counts of hemoglobin (a), red blood cells (RBCs) (b), platelets (c) and white blood cells (WBCs) (d) in all the mouse groups. e–h, The counts of myeloid progenitor cells (MPCs) (lineage−cKIT+SCA1−) (e), KLS (cKIT+lineage−SCA1+) cells (f), HSCs (g) and multipotent progenitors (MPPs) (lineage−SCA1+cKIT+CD150−CD48−) (h) per million cells within murine BM. i, The hematopoietic volume in murine BM. j, The frequencies of myeloid cells (CD45+Gr-1+), B cells (CD45+CD3−B220+) and T cells (CD45+CD3+B220−) among CD45+ cells in murine BM. The data are presented as the mean ± s.e.m. (*P < 0.05, **P < 0.01, ***P < 0.001, ****P < 0.0001).
